Omar Bernal was born in Mexico. A transdisciplinary artist interested in the concepts of identity, destiny and diversity, he arrived in Quebec in 2016 and has since been actively collaborating with renowned artists (including Patrick Beaulieu) in the creation of public artworks (such as the architectural integration projects for the Montreal Museum of Fine Arts and the Sherbrooke Cathedral), and with the organization “l’Atelier 19” in various artistic projects with an ecological and social integration approach. These achievements have allowed him to travel and realize public art and social integration projects in Bromont, Farnham and now in Montreal.
